READ MORESeniors who want to remain in the community but need additional help with daily tasks, including shopping, dressing and home maintenance, may consider assisted living. These facilities offer 24-hour personal care with resort-style amenities and fun activities to help residents maintain their health and social connections. Despite the area’s high cost of living, assisted living prices in the Phoenix metropolitan area are lower than in other parts of the state and nation. According to Genworth’s 2020 Cost of Care Survey, the median cost of assisted living care in Paradise Valley is $3,700 per month.

READ MOREAssisted living centers and personal care homes in Paradise Valley must follow strict standards established by the Arizona Department of Health Services, Bureau of Residential Facilities Licensing to obtain a license and remain certified. These standards are designed to protect residents’ health, safety and dignity.
The median cost of assisted living in Paradise Valley is $3,700 per month, according to Genworth Financial’s 2020 Cost of Care Survey.
Seniors in Paradise Valley and other parts of Maricopa County enjoy competitive assisted living rates that are $200 lower than the state median and $600 lower than the national average. Monthly prices in other metropolitan areas in the southern part of the state are $325 to $750 higher on average. Prescott Valley is the most expensive option at $4,450. Rates in Tucson and Yuma are also higher than the state median at $4,075 and $4,025, respectively.

Residential and institutional long-term care costs in Paradise Valley vary significantly. Prices start at $867 for adult day health care, which is about one-fourth the cost of assisted living. Home care prices range from $5,148 for homemaker services to $5,243 for medical services provided by a home health aide. Still, this is a competitive value when compared to skilled nursing. Seniors can expect to pay $9,247 for a semiprivate nursing home room or $10,646 for a private room, which is almost three times higher than assisted living.

Seniors living in Paradise Valley have access to three programs that may help them pay for assisted living, including Supplemental Security Income, Arizona Health Care Cost Containment System and Arizona Non-Medical, Home and Community Based Services.

Area Agency on Aging, Region One | (602) 264-4357 | Seniors who want to learn more about public benefits and community-based resources available in Paradise Valley can contact their Area Agency on Aging for assistance. This informational clearinghouse publishes an elder resource guide, manages the local senior volunteer program in partnership with AmeriCorps and helps residents maximize their Medicare benefits. It offers legal advice and ombudsman services for long-term care residents. Seniors and caregivers can learn more about these programs by contacting the agency's 24-hour helpline. |
Paradise Valley Senior Center | (602) 262-4520 | Paradise Valley is home to one of 15 senior centers operated by the Phoenix Department of Human Services. The center features a library and lounge that are used for cards, games and quiet activities. Seniors can participate in a wide variety of fitness classes, including yoga, tai chi and aerobics. It offers courses for residents who enjoy art, ceramics, quilting, music, knitting or crochet. The campus is also home to the Paradise Valley Community Center and the town's public swimming pool. Annual membership costs $20 and gives residents access to all 15 senior centers. Transportation is available via taxi. |
Maricopa Community Colleges Lifelong Learning | (480) 731-8000 | Paradise Valley is known for its well-educated residents, and seniors aged 65 and older can continue their educational journey at discounted rates, thanks to Maricopa Community Colleges' Lifelong Learning program. Seniors qualify for half-price tuition on all credit classes offered at 10 local campuses, and enrolled students can take advantage of on-campus fitness centers and other services. Discounts don't apply to fees or noncredit courses. |
Society of St. Vincent de Paul Phoenix Medical Equipment Loan Closet | (602) 261-6896 | Located on the society's Watkins Road campus, St. Vincent de Paul's Medical Equipment Loan Closet provides durable medical equipment to individuals who are uninsured or are unable to afford these items on their own. It stocks wheelchairs, crutches, shower chairs, bedside commodes, transfer benches and rehabilitative items. It also accepts donations from residents who no longer need these items. |
